Messe Frankfurt confirms German pavilion concept at Expo Milano 2015

EUROPE - Messe Frankfurt has revealed the German pavilion design at Expo Milano 2015 will be have the theme of ‘Feeding the Planet – Energy for Life’.
 
The Federal Ministry of Economics and Technology (BMWi) and the consortium of Milla & Partner, Schmidhuber and Nüssli developed content ideas and architectural design around the key issues of sustainable development. The consortium said the design will highlight the commercial and cultural relationship between Germany and Italy, and set new standards for a shared European future.

Expo Milan 2015 takes place from 1 May to 31 October 2015, where Germany will have the largest plot on site, at 4,913sqm.
 
"The key features of the concept are that it abandons the usual pathways that guide visitors around the pavilion and closely interlinks the presentation of space and content," said Schmidhuber managing partner Lennart Wiechell. "We want to communicate the themes of the exhibition in the German pavilion in a fun and entertaining way,” said Milla & Partner creative director Peter Redlin. “We want to motivate people to join in and inspire them to take matters into their own hands."
